Technical Data Sheet

impact performanceTest ConditionTest MethodTest ResultTest Unit
Dart impact23°C, Energy at PeakASTM D376351.0J
Dart impact-30°C, Energy at PeakASTM D376332.0J
flammabilityTest ConditionTest MethodTest ResultTest Unit
UL flame retardant rating1.5 mmUL 94V-1
UL flame retardant rating6.0 mmUL 94V-0
Radiation board gradeRP100
mechanical propertiesTest ConditionTest MethodTest ResultTest Unit
bending strengthYield, 100 mm SpanASTM D790102Mpa
Bending modulus100 mm SpanASTM D7902500Mpa
elongationBreakASTM D63820%
elongationYieldASTM D6388.1%
tensile strengthBreakASTM D63853.0Mpa
tensile strengthYieldASTM D63867.0Mpa
injectionTest ConditionTest MethodTest ResultTest Unit
drying temperature105 to 110°C
drying time3.0 to 4.0hr
Suggested maximum moisture content0.020%
Suggested injection volume30 to 70%
Temperature at the rear of the barrel250 to 300°C
Temperature in the middle of the barrel260 to 305°C
Temperature at the front of the material cylinder270 to 310°C
Spray nozzle temperature280 to 310°C
Processing (melt) temperature280 to 310°C
Mold temperature75 to 105°C
Back pressure0.300 to 0.700Mpa
Screw speed20 to 100rpm
thermal performanceTest ConditionTest MethodTest ResultTest Unit
RTIUL 746110°C
RTI ImpUL 746105°C
RTI ElecUL 746110°C
Hot deformation temperature1.8 MPa, Unannealed, 6.40 mmASTM D648117°C
Hot deformation temperature0.45 MPa, Unannealed, 6.40 mmASTM D648126°C
Physical propertiesTest ConditionTest MethodTest ResultTest Unit
Outdoor applicabilityUL 746Cf1
Water absorption rate24 hrASTM D5700.060%
Shrinkage rateAcross FlowFlow 2Internal Method0.50 - 0.70%
Shrinkage rateFlow : 3.20 mmInternal Method0.50 - 0.70%
Electrical performanceTest ConditionTest MethodTest ResultTest Unit
Dissipation factor60 HzASTM D1503.4E-3
Dissipation factor50 HzASTM D1503.4E-3
Dielectric constant1 MHzASTM D1502.46
Dielectric constant50 kHzASTM D1502.52
Surface resistivityASTM D257> 1.0E+15ohms
Dielectric constant60 HzASTM D1502.52
Dielectric strength3.20 mm, in OilASTM D14918KV/mm
Volume resistivityASTM D2572.3E+16ohms·cm
Dissipation factor1 MHzASTM D1502.1E-3
Arc resistanceASTM D495PLC 6
Compared to the anti leakage trace indexUL 746PLC 1
High voltage arc tracing rateUL 746PLC 4
